Shallow water waves are governed by a pair of non-linear partial differential equations. We transfer the associated homogeneous and non-homogeneous systems, (corresponding to constant and sloping depth, respectively), to the hodograph plane where we find all the non-simple wave solutions and construct infinitely many polynomial conservation laws. The short timescale temporal ev~lution of buoyancy-driven coastal flow over sloping bottom topography is examined using a two-dimensional, vertically averaged numerical model. Winter shelf circulation driven by a coastal "point source" buoyancy flux is modeled by initiating a coastal outflow with density anomaly t into well-mixed shelf water. Watertable waves generated by forcing from oceanic oscillations play an important role in the availability and quality of coastal groundwater resources. Here we present results from laboratory experiments which examine the influence of a boundary slope on the mass transfer from an oscillating clear water reservoir into a homogeneous, unconfined aquifer.
